Psychiatrists A psychiatrist is a medical professional who is skilled in treating mental health issues and diagnoseable disorders. They may prescribe medications and offer psychotherapy as a part of treatment. They may also order and interpret lab tests and brain scans like CT scans or CAT scans. They are able to work with patients of all ages, ranging from children to seniors. In certain instances Psychiatrists are part of a clinical team that includes psychologists or therapists that provide the client with psychotherapy. Psychiatrists are highly trained professionals who treat many types of disorders, including depression, anxiety bipolar disorder, depression and schizophrenia. They are medical professionals with advanced degrees and can prescribe medication to help patients manage their symptoms. Psychotherapy is a different service offered by psychiatrists. Psychological Consultants Psychiatrists are medical doctors who specialize in mental health. They can diagnose and treat a variety mental disorders, including bipolar disorder, anxiety, depression and disorder. They are also able to prescribe medication for these disorders. In addition, they are able to assist patients in understanding and managing their condition through providing assistance and advising on psychotherapy. There are a variety of sub-specialties within the field psychiatry, such as pediatric and Geriatric. Child psychiatrists are those who work with young children, while geriatric psychiatric psychiatrists are those who specialize in elderly patients. The latter have particular expertise in the effects of aging on mental health. Psychologists can conduct physical examinations, order blood tests, and interpret brain scans as well as lab images. They may also offer psychotherapy, which is a type of talk therapy that helps people manage the symptoms of their condition.
